Joseph Sackett

(c 1798-1851)
FatherNathaniel Sackett (1763-1812)
MotherBethiah Reynolds (1767-1809)
Joseph Sackett, son of Nathaniel Sackett and Bethiah Reynolds, was born in about 17981 and died aged 53 in December 1851.2 He married Anna Augusta Downing, daughter of George Downing.1 Anna was born in about 18133 and baptized as an adult at All Saints Church, New York CityG, on 25 September 1842.4 She was confirmed at All Saints ChurchG on 2 April 1843 and removed from the church in May 1845. Her address at that date was 30 Rutgers Street.5,6 She died at Brick Church, New Jersey, on 13 December 1886.7
     Joseph was for many years engaged with his brother James in the wholesale carpet trade in New York City.8
     Joseph was named in his father's will made in Bedford, New York StateG, on 13 March 1812.8
